What Does It Take to Start a Window Cleaning Business?
Starting your personal window cleaning commercial enterprise might possibly be quite uncomplicated. The preliminary fee will be incredibly low as compared to different carrier-orientated agencies. How a great deal does it rate to start window cleaning? Generally conversing, you would want anyplace from $1,000 to $10,000 based on points resembling device good quality and advertising efforts.

Average Earnings for Window Cleaners
Professional window cleaners characteristically earn among $15 to $30 according to hour depending on sense and geographical vicinity. In metropolitan locations or regions with excessive residing rates like Lynchburg VA, pay is also at the increased end of that scale.
Potential Annual Income
For full-time staff putting in place about forty hours every week:
- At $15/hour: Approximately $31,two hundred annually At $30/hour: Approximately $62,four hundred annually

Window Cleaning Pricing Insights
For the ones specially trying into pricing within Lynchburg VA:
Average Costs of Window Cleaning Services
The quotes might also vary situated on belongings variety (residential vs advertisement), length of home windows, and frequency of service:
- Residential homes routinely range from $a hundred-$three hundred according to session Commercial contracts may possibly deliver in as much as $500 in keeping with visit depending on size
